How do they work?

Most robot vacuums use sensor technology to determine the dimensions of a room. They also utilize infrared signals to detect walls, doors and furniture. This helps them map out rooms and make efficient cleaning paths. This feature is particularly beneficial for homes that have multiple rooms and big floors. It also helps to avoid collisions with furniture and walls. Self-cleaning vacuums also keep track of their location so that they don't get lost or not able to locate their way back.

Another benefit of robot cleaners is that they will save you a lot of time. They can be controlled by your tablet or smartphone and operate according to a schedule you decide to set. This is perfect for busy families who wish to reduce time while maintaining a clean house when they return home. Some models even let you use them while you are away on vacation or work.

best robot vacuum cleaner vacuums are excellent in keeping floors clean, but they cannot remove dirt that is embedded in carpets or rug. In addition, they often leave dust in the vicinity of baseboards and thresholds. Additionally, their obstacle-avoidance sensors aren't as effective as those found in traditional cordless and upright vacuums. Therefore, it is important to clean up before beginning the machine and create no-go zones in areas filled with socks, toys, or other items that can become tangled.

Many robot vacuums utilize sensors-based navigation systems to avoid obstacles and return to their docking station if the battery is running low. A docking station can be used to store bags or a filter that requires to be replaced. They can also be configured to run on a timer or be triggered by voice commands.

The most expensive robotic vacuum cleaners include the feature dToF Laser Navigation. It utilizes a laser scanner to identify and navigate around objects. It can detect objects that are up to 14 feet and can detect small spaces, such as chairs legs and under furniture. It also can detect different kinds of flooring and stains. flooring. It is more precise than previous models and is able to be used on a variety of floors, including wood, tile, and carpet.

They are an excellent maintenance cleaner

In contrast to traditional vacuum cleaners self-cleaning vacuums are constructed with powerful suction and advanced filtration systems to trap and remove airborne allergens. They include dust mites, pollen and pet dander, and other common household pollutants which can trigger respiratory symptoms and allergies for those who are susceptible. They can also create an environment that is healthier by eliminating pet fur and other pollutants. They are easy to operate and provide a hands-free method to keep your home tidy and allergen-free.

Using a robot vacuum as a maintenance cleaner can reduce the need for more intense cleanings, and can save you time and money in the long run. These machines are capable of navigating through tight spaces, under furniture and along edges and can capture dirt and dust that is often missed by standard vacuums. These self-cleaning vacuums are perfect for those with mobility issues or busy schedules, since they allow you to take over one of the most time-consuming tasks.

Some self-cleaning vacuums can be operated by smartphones which allow you to start, pause and schedule cleaning sessions remotely. This feature is particularly beneficial for pet owners who want to set their vacuums up to automatically clean on a regular basis and avoid the accumulation of pet hair and allergens. Moreover, these machines include automatic emptying stations and ZeroTangle anti-tangle technology, which reduces the risk of overfilled dustbins and blocked brushes.

They are effective in reducing amount dirt and allergens however they might not be able to clean your home in the same way as a high-quality upright or canister. Even the top models struggle to remove tiny particles that are hidden in rugs, and they can also be unable to pick up dirt near baseboards and thresholds. They can also get tangled up in cords or toys as well as other things. To avoid this, you should still regularly clear off surfaces and move clutter before letting a robot vacuum through your home.

They are simple to make use of

Consider a robot vacuum that is able to empty itself. These new-age machines have taken the cleaning industry by storm and are a great method to keep your floors spotless and free of allergens. Self-emptying Robots can automatically empty their trash bins, preventing accumulation of debris which can lead to blockages or lower efficiency. They also have a no-tangle cleaning method to keep the brushes from becoming stuck.

A self-emptying robot cleaner can also help you save time on routine cleaning chores, such as emptying dustbins or floor washing robot filters. Furthermore, some models come with self-charging capabilities and can be controlled remotely using an app or voice commands. This means that you can plan and begin cleaning sessions even when you are not at home.

Robot vacuums and mops utilize a variety of sensors to map out the space they operate. Infrared sensors detect obstacles and assist them in avoiding collisions and cameras and laser sensors capture images and data to create an image of the environment. This information is used in order to design a clean route that eliminates unnecessary movements and ensures uniform coverage across all areas.

Smart vacuums and mops are designed to help conserve energy by intelligently controlling and optimizing their cleaning routes. They can switch to a low-power mode whenever needed, reducing energy usage. They can be connected to Wi-Fi networks, which allows remote control vacuum cleaner control via an app or voice commands.

Many smart vacuums and mops can be controlled from your tablet or smartphone via an application developed by the manufacturer. The app lets you plan cleaning sessions, modify settings for navigation and mapping and monitor battery status. Some robots are able to monitor their own performance and send notifications when there is a problem.

In addition to reducing the time spent on cleaning, a smart vacuum will also help you save money on replacement bags and other cleaning products. The majority of these vacuums come with a couple of bags of replacement included in the base, however you'll need additional bags if you intend to use them frequently.
